Scene 5 - Time Limit
Watching the twins destroy the western front with ease made Grorc smile slightly, ‘Perhaps we’ll all make out with their firepower. But first I have to convince the egotistical to work together.’
With such thoughts, Grorc went over to the fan maiden first who was eating some unknown type of grapes he had never seen before. Seeing the Orc walking over to her resting the fan maiden put away her food tilting her head, “What do you want?”
“I wish to gather all the top experts together after the time limit is up which will be soon.”
“Time limit? What time limit?”
Grorc ran his hand through his hair and bashfully smiled, “Ah so you don't know some of the insider information, it seems we got the ‘hunters’ this time. Since it’s the hunters then they will only have eight hours to hunt us before closing up shop for the day.”
Pulling out a small fan the Fan Maiden started airing her face, “Meaning?”
Grorc continued speaking, “Meaning that we’ll be stuck here for a few days or maybe even until the end of the exam depending on what they have in store for our group.”
The Fan Maidens eyes shined brightly, “Ah! That means we don’t have to be running and escaping with the total points we gathered! Wait that’s only if everyone here has more then at least one hundred points.”
“Exactly which is why I wanted to talk with you, that middle age man, that brown haired youth and those twins.”
“Eh? Those little shits? Didn’t you hear that little girl pronounce that she would kill us all? Why would you want to talk to them? I mean do you see how she treats those skulls and how brutal she is in combat?”
Advertisement
They both took a look at Luna when she said that and watched her jump on the shoulders of an Elf Zombie. She then impaled her spear on the top of its head until the spear was halfway in before doing a power throw flinging the body at an incoming swarm of Zombies.
Her body was drenched in black blood and with her eyes crimson laughing as she toyed with the zombies to her heart's content. A true psychopath thought the Fan Maiden as he turned to Grorc, “See?”
Waving with his hand Grorc replied, “A minor manner, she has a brother does she not? See that boy facing off against that Death Knight? With him, we can keep her in line. Oh, he just killed it what an excellent move.”
Turning her head in time the Fan Maiden saw Sol severing the Death Knight head with one well-placed strike before using his foot to smash the skull to pieces.
‘What a profound slash for a child so young.’
Grorc spoke up interrupting the Fan maidens, “The silver-haired man already agreed to talk if we have you then it’ll be easy to get the other three to agree. Besides group two is about to finish up.”
Indeed as he said there was only about one hundred zombies life, they would be done in a minute or so. After they finished the next group expected to head out only to see the clock timer read 16 hours before the next wave.
One of the youths itching to go out and do battle snorted, “Whats the meaning of this! I wanted to fight those zombies!”
To which the necromancer brothers appeared, “Oh we forget to mention that we can only hunt for 8 hours a day meaning you guys can rest here for 16 hours. When those up we can start the next wave.”
Advertisement
One of the youths dissatisfied, “Than how are supposed to earn points! I only have 81!”
The younger brother smiled cutely but his words were chilling, “Simple really kill each other oh wait you can’t haha! Enjoy your stay!”
The two then faded out of existence watching the youths grit their teeth in anger and curse them under their breaths. The Fan Maiden didn’t pay attention to cultivators and instead paid attention to this Orc, seeing that he had some insider information it would be best to hear him out, “Alright I’ll agree to talk.”
With a smile Grorc held a hand out, “Then let's go shall we?”
